1-2 shifts per week 06:30 -1500, every other weekendPosition SummaryThe Medical Technologist is an excellent technical opportunity at MultiCare, responsible for performing patient analytic laboratory testing, quality control, data analysis, results reporting, instrument maintenance and technical problem resolution. This position requires a service-committed individual, who is detail oriented and can perform complex data analysis, exercise sound, independent judgment and demonstrate critical thinking skills.

ResponsibilitiesYou will receive specimens, establish and maintain positive identification of specimensYou will determine suitability of specimenYou will acquire/prepare reagents as neededYou will perform instrument maintenance and calibrationRequirementsBachelor's degree in Medical Technology or SciencesCertification or registry eligible

for Medical Technologist, MLS (ASCP), or MT (ASCP), or AMTSM (ASCP), RM (NRM) for Microbiology onlyCurrent Medical Assistant-Phlebotomist (MA-P) certification or Medical Assistant-Phlebotomist eligible (if duties will include phlebotomy)SC, SM (ASCP), MS in Clinical Chemistry or molecular diagnostics experience preferred for Immunology onlyOur ValuesAs a MultiCare employee, we'll rely on you to reflect our core values of Respect, Integrity, Stewardship, Excellence, Collaboration, Kindness and Joy.
